天津光盘印刷 杭州光盘制作 武汉光盘印刷 北京企业宣传片上海企业专题片 广州影视广告 深圳企业宣传片 天津企业专题片 厦门影视广告 西安企业宣传片 大连企业专题片 青岛影视广告
发新话题
打印

一个有关改变分辨率的问题~

一个有关改变分辨率的问题~

我编写如下程序,它说没有BNA_SetDisplay函数,该怎么办呢?
为什么我会没有这个函数呢~去哪找~
x:=ScreenWidth   --保存当前设置到变量
y:=ScreenHeight  --保存当前设置到变量
color:=ScreenDepth   --保存当前设置到变量
if x<>1024|y<>768 then
BNA_SetDisplay(1024,768,16)         --调整显示器(1024*768*
16) (binapi.u32)
end if
退出要恢先前的分辨率
BNA_SetDisplay(x,y,color)  --恢复先前的显示器设置

TOP

这个函数是滨滨写的,网上有流传~~binapi.u32
附件: 您所在的用户组无法下载或查看附件

TOP

哦.......问你个比较无力的问题,怎样使用这个函数?怎样插入~
呵呵,我刚学。
还有,如果我想在开头再加一个对话框,建议改变分辨率,怎样操作~是不是用计算图标之类的?

TOP

if SystemMessageBox(WindowHandle, "是否修改屏幕分辨率?", "Confirmation", 36)=6 then
    这里写调整的代码,或goto到调整的地方
end if

在函数面板下拉框里选择当前文件,下面的载入按钮会激活,点击,选择u32文件,打开后选择需要载入的函数,

TOP

这个了解了!谢谢,非常感谢!

TOP

支持啊!谢谢贡献。找了好久!

TOP

发新话题